A new water heater installation done correctly means the right unit for your household size, proper gas line sizing, correct venting, seismic strapping per California code, and a final pressure and temperature check before we leave. Get any of those wrong and you end up with a unit that underperforms or fails early.

When to Install a New Water Heater
Your current unit is 10+ years old (tank) or 15+ years old (tankless)
Hot water runs out faster than it used to
Rust-colored water from hot taps
Visible corrosion or sediment at the base of the tank
You’re remodeling and upgrading to a tankless system
